What will the weather in Uenohara be like during my vacation?
August and July are typically the warmest months in Uenohara when the average temp is 75°F. January and February are the coldest months when the average temperature is 42°F. September and October are the months with the most rain.

Uenohara: Where Ancient Temples Embrace Nature’s Serenity

Nestled in the serene Yamanashi Prefecture, Uenohara is an enchanting escape for nature lovers and culture seekers alike. This charming town boasts stunning views of the iconic Mount Fuji and is home to historical treasures like the remnants of Uenohara Castle and ancient temples. Visitors can rejuvenate in the soothing hot springs or embark on scenic hikes through the lush landscapes of the Chichibu-Tama-Kai National Park. Uenohara’s tranquil vibe, combined with its rich heritage and proximity to attractions like the Aokigahara Forest, makes it a perfect off-the-beaten-path destination for a romantic getaway or a peaceful retreat.

Best time to go to Uenohara

Uenohara exper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 38.5°F (3.6°C), while August is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 79.7°F (26.5°C). September is usually the wettest month. April, July, and September are the peak travel months in Uenohara,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by light to moderate rainfall. On the other hand, January, February, and December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
